Key Facts
- Southern Accents's instance of is recorded as album[3].
- Southern Accents's genre is heartland rock[4].
- Southern Accents was produced by Jimmy Iovine[5].
- Southern Accents was performed by Tom Petty and the Heartbreakers[6].
- Southern Accents's record label is recorded as MCA Inc.[7].
- Southern Accents is part of Tom Petty and the Heartbreakers' albums in chronological order[8].
- Southern Accents's language of work or name is recorded as English[9].
- Southern Accents was distributed by vinyl record[10].
- Southern Accents was released on 1985[11].
